Table of Contents
I can’t say enough good things about how Helix Core has changed the way our organization handles version control and teamwork. This business-level software, made by Perforce, has completely changed how we handle our digital files and source codes. It’s more than just a tool; it’s a dynamic solution that has made it easier for development teams of all kinds to work together. One thing that makes Helix Core stand out is its obvious power, which lets us move through our work more quickly and easily. It’s more than just version control; it helps our development teams work together.
Modern development teams want control and flexibility, especially when they’re working on making complicated digital systems. The platform gives them both. Helix Core is now an important part of our continuous delivery process, and it can easily grow to fit assets and teams of all shapes and sizes. Helix Core is unique because it can store digital files safely in a central repository and make multiple versions of them. Every day, thousands of deals happen, and Helix Core handles the load with ease, sending files to remote servers without any problems.
With its support for multifactor authentication and other strong security features, the software has become the best secure version control option available online. From my point of view, Helix Core is more than just a tool; it’s a reliable partner in our journey of growth. As we move quickly through the digital world, it’s the key that keeps our projects running smoothly and gives us the stability and protection we need. As someone who was very active in the development process, I can say that Helix Core has made our work much more efficient, helped us work together better, and made the project a success as a whole.
Helix Core Specification
Perforce Software’s Helix Core is a robust version control system (VCS) that was developed by the company. It provides a wide variety of capabilities that may be utilised by teams of any size in order to manage their code.
Feature | Description |
---|---|
Version Control | Track changes to files and code over time. |
Branching and Merging | Create and manage multiple versions of code simultaneously. |
Parallel Development | Multiple users can work on the same codebase concurrently. |
Atomic Change Transactions | All changes within a change list are committed successfully or not at all. |
Security and Permissions | Granular control over access to files and code. |
Scalability and Performance | Supports large codebases and distributed teams. |
Integration with Other Tools | Integrates with popular IDEs, build systems, and CI/CD pipelines. |
Command-Line Interface (CLI) | Powerful and flexible CLI for advanced users. |
GUI Clients | User-friendly graphical interfaces for beginners and advanced users. |
Data Replication and Redundancy | Replicate data across servers for high availability and disaster recovery. |
Visit Website |
What is Helix Core?

The Fast Software Configuration Management System, often known as Perforce, is a powerful solution that allows businesses to manage and version their source code as well as other digital assets. The installation, learning, and administration of Perforce are all simple, and it handles distributed development in a smooth manner. Additionally, it provides support for developers across a wide variety of platforms. Using its Inter-File Branching mechanism, Perforce guarantees the integrity of the development process by aggregating updates to numerous files into atomic changes. Additionally, it enables parallel development and intelligently manages various software releases.
Helix Core review: Distributed workflow
Distributed version control systems, also known as DVCS, provide developers with the powerful features of Helix Core. These systems provide a dynamic solution for effective collaboration and version control. Through the Helix Visual Client or command line interface, Helix Core offers developers a dynamic experience that enables them to take use of the speed and flexibility offered by local repositories. Developers are able to effortlessly react to shifting priorities when they have the option to branch locally at a high frequency.
The support for narrow cloning that is included in Helix Core significantly simplifies the process by allowing users to clone certain slices or files from the repository. This improves precision and speeds up workflows. In the context of contemporary software development, Helix Core is an invaluable asset because of its all-encompassing approach to version control, which guarantees that developers will be able to manage their projects with agility and responsiveness.
Helix Core review: IP protection
Helix Core is a strong version control and collaboration tool made to protect an organization’s intellectual property (IP), which is very important in today’s digital world. Multi-Factor Authentication (MFA) and carefully chosen privilege sets in Helix Core make sure that both data and users are very safe. This app gives you more power over access permissions than any other, so companies can say exactly who can see what, right down to the file level. It can get down to individual users, IP addresses, and even file paths.
One thing that makes Helix Core stand out is its full audit trail, which records every action that was taken in the system. This includes details about the changes that were made, the files that were viewed, the people who did these things, and the times they happened. This amount of openness not only makes things safer, but it also helps with compliance. Helix Core also goes the extra mile by keeping audit compliance logs with file signatures. This makes sure that private information has a strong chain of custody. Helix Core is basically a strong option for businesses that want to make their data safer while also keeping a thorough record of their online actions.
Helix Core review: Flexibility

Helix Core is a flexible version control system that was carefully made to work with a wide range of development styles. Your team can use centralised or distributed version control systems (DVCS), follow traditional workflows, or choose the more modern streams method.
Helix Core can easily adjust to your needs. This ability to change gives your team unmatched freedom and lets them use the best of both worlds. You are free to pick the methods that work best for your team and the needs of the job. Helix Core also does more than just version control; it makes it easy to work together and connect to different systems. It’s the most important part of your development process because it lets other tools connect and work with it easily, so you can test, integrate, and release code all the time.
This not only makes your tasks easier, but it also makes your development processes more efficient and productive as a whole. Helix Core is a strong option that lets development teams pick the methods they like best while also making it easy for them to work together and integrate throughout the whole software development process.
Final Words
Helix Core has helped me and improved my software development process. This robust version control and collaboration platform has become a trusted companion that helps me streamline and improve my development operations. Helix Core’s central repository changed everything for me. I can manage source code, assets, and artefacts faster and more reliably across the development lifecycle. Change tracking and versioning are now second nature to me. They improve teamwork and protect my projects.
This independence has really improved my ability to tackle growing challenges. My job is also more efficient because Helix Core works well with typical programming tools. This connection saves time and streamlines job switching, increasing productivity over time. The security features of Helix Core have given me confidence in protecting intellectual property throughout my development path. Being confident that my job is safe allows me focus on creating without thinking about danger.
Helix Core review: The Good and Bad
Helix Core uses the same versioning engine that Perforce users trust to handle assets at the file level very quickly. Helix Core keeps all digital material, even big files, safe in a single repository and sends files quickly to large teams that work in different places.
The Good
- Powerful version control capabilities
- Enhanced collaboration features
- Scalable infrastructure for growing projects
- Advanced security measures to safeguard code
- Flexible customization options to suit diverse workflows
The Bad
- Learning curve for new users
- Initial setup may be complex for inexperienced teams
- License costs for larger teams
Questions and Answers
For a maximum of five users and twenty workspaces, Helix Core is cost-free. You will get access to all of the same features and functionality that have gained Helix Core the trust of 19/20 of the top AAA game development firms, as well as the top visual effects studios and semiconductor companies from across the world.
At the present time, it is widely used by professional teams of varying sizes, ranging from independent software engineers to major corporations, as well as important open-source projects like Android and the Linux kernel. Despite this, game developers and other subsets of software developers continue to utilise Perforce, which is a commercially available centralised supply chain management solution.